'Xpat Theatre: DramaWorks Child-Friendly Musicals, 3 June
On 3 June Sunday, 3 child-friendly musical performances starring children aged 5-13 years will be presented by DramaWorks.

'The Litter Muncher’ – 10:30

In Lazy Spacey Village the grass is green, the flowers are pretty and all the streets and pavements are clean and tidy. But what will happen when their Litter Muncher becomes too tired to collect all the litter.

This delightful musical is set in space and full of colourful alien characters.

English language musical starring students aged 5-6yrs.

Written by Niki Davies
Directed by Christine Szarko
 

'Peter Pan’ – 14:30

Peter and tinker Bell carry us off to magical Neverland where children never grow up! We meet Captain Hook and his crew, the Lost Kids and Mermaids of the Lagoon.

This is a delightful, fun and rocking version of the classic tale.

English language musical starring students aged 7-9yrs.

Based on the works of J. M. Barrie adapted by Kathryn Schultz Miller
Directed by Christine Szarko

’Robin and the Sherwood Hoodies’ – 17:30

In this hysterical show the evil Sheriff of Nottingham and his gormless guards threaten the villagers of Sherwood, feisty Maid Marion hires a band of freedom fighters for protection. But when Robin and Co. arrive, she soon discovers they're not exactly what she'd ordered.

English language musical starring students aged 10-13yrs.

Written by Craig Hawes
Directed by Christine Szarko
 

Tickets: adults 1500 HUF / children 1000 HUF
To book a ticket, send an email to contact@dramaworks.hu

Venue: Tárogató Stage (former IBS Stage)
Address: 1021 Budapest, Tárogató út 4.
